What Is Green Mobility?
Green Mobility develops corporate programmes to reduce commute trips in cities by private motor vehicles. This does not just reduce traffic congestion, but also improves public transportation systems and quality of life.
Sustainable transportation options can help to reduce the impact of climate change and air pollution and also be used to promote an active lifestyle that can bring health benefits. Green mobility includes:
Policy Interventions
Green mobility can be achieved by various policies. green electric scooter of policy is spatial strategies that aim to restrain urban car traffic and encourage the use of sustainable transport modes. These are typically small-scale interventions, such as limitations on parking or speed limits, or the use cycle lanes. They are nimble, as they can be tailored according to the local context.
Another set of guidelines aims to change the modal structure by promoting alternative fuels and technologies (e.g. EVs) or by encouraging sharing of vehicles and routes. These policies can also include measures to improve accessibility to public transportation services, for example by offering financial incentives or increasing mobility options.
The promotion of green mobility can be a catalyst for changing the business model, economic development and land-use planning. This requires political will, and a high degree of coordination between sectors. Additionally, it must be noted that a broad and fair shift to green mobility will require addressing existing inequalities. In cities that have the highest concentration of high-value jobs, such as business services, information and communications technology growing green mobility can result in an increase in access to areas of the upper and middle classes while reducing opportunities and jobs in communities with lower incomes.
A third set policy instruments aims to reduce negative externalities associated with transportation, and promotes more sustainable energy sources like carbon pricing and renewables. These policies are able to be implemented at local, national and EU levels. These policies can be implemented at local, national and EU levels. They could also help promote the development of electric vehicles and charging infrastructure, and encourage a switch to sustainable transportation. At the local level, this might include implementing measures that aim to promote the sustainability culture and creating new habits through education, awareness campaigns and many other initiatives. At the national and EU level, this could include using global economic stimuli to spur consumer purchase of EVs and increasing the speed of high-speed railways, as well as supporting research and development in the field of hydrogen and batteries.
EV Adoption
The speed at which cars move from traditional internal combustion (IC) to EV power is influenced by a variety of factors. One of them is that the country's economic situation as well as national policy impact how EV adoption can grow. Norway and China have historically been the two countries that have supported EV production, with high incentives for consumers. green power scooter reviews helped a vibrant EV market to develop, which in turn helped reduce costs.
These countries also have strong energy policies that promote sustainable energy usage. Additionally, they are committed to the development of a large public charging infrastructure to help reduce the fear of range for consumers who are just beginning to adopt electric vehicles. This strategy has had a positive effect on overall EV adoption. This is evident in the data for vehicle-in-use that indicates that the proportion of the fleet that is EV grows faster than registrations for new vehicles or retirements.
Despite these positive trends, EV adoption remains below expectations. The good news is that the rate of growth is predicted to increase based on technological advancements in the near future, which should bring battery prices down even more. Many Considerers and Skeptics are likely to switch to EV ownership earlier.
The escalating rise in EV ownership has also been fueled by more people using EVs to transport their work. They can aid in shifting the company's fleets to greener alternatives. This will reduce the carbon footprint of a company and contribute towards the goal of creating a future without mobility.
In the end, the speed at which EVs replace conventional vehicles will be impacted by whether policymakers in government choose to prioritize long-term investments or short-term incentives. Whatever direction a country takes it is crucial to remember that, for EVs to be successful and the most sustainable option for environmental sustainability, they need to become a larger share of the fleet. This is only possible with the help of all stakeholders including consumers, governments and the entire ecosystem of industry.
EV Charging Infrastructure
To realize the benefits of an electrified transportation sector, owners of electric vehicles require a reliable charging infrastructure. Public EV chargers can be installed in workplaces, parking garages, multiunit dwellings and other public spaces. This includes home charging stations which EV drivers can install themselves, as well as portable chargers that can help reduce the anxiety of driving in a range.
This charging infrastructure is a key component of electrification of the transportation system and contributes to the nation's goals for clean energy. It is being constructed across rural, suburban and urban communities. The Biden Administration partners with state and local governments in order to promote EV adoption. This is done by making it easier to invest in charging infrastructures that are new.
EV charging can be an efficient safe and healthy alternative to traditional gasoline-powered cars and trucks. It can help reduce emissions of greenhouse gases as well as air pollution and aid in reducing climate change. It also can help support economic growth and generate high-wage jobs.
Despite the numerous benefits an EV offers but there are obstacles to its widespread use. This includes the expense of the EV and the absence of charging infrastructure for public use. Offering equal access to EV chargers can help overcome these barriers and ensure that all members of the community are able to benefit from green mobility's health and environmental benefits.
This can be achieved by establishing a public network of charging stations for electric vehicles within the community. In addition, it could be promoted through programs that offer incentives to private entities and companies to install EV chargers at their premises. This could include tax credits, rebates and other financial benefits.
A simplified permitting process can simplify the process for homeowners and businesses to set up EV charging stations on their property. Additionally, developing an established set of best practices to design and implement EV charging stations can help ensure that they are efficient, effective and easy to use.
In the end, using existing technology to improve EV charger efficiencies can be a method for communities to encourage the sustainability of an EV charging network. This can be accomplished by the integration of EV charging infrastructure with smart city technology that gathers and analyzes data in order to inform better energy use decisions.
EV Integration
The integration of EVs to the grid requires consideration of multiple stakeholders and systems that are involved in urban mobility services. The integration of EVs also requires the creation of new technologies to manage the flow of energy from EVs to and from the grid. In addition, EVs provide opportunities for the integration of renewable energy (RE) in the electricity supply system by utilizing vehicle-to-grid (V2G) and grid-to-vehicle (G2V) capabilities. This allows EV owners to take advantage of energy prices arbitrage and to sign lower-cost contracts with energy providers. Moreover, EVs can provide back-up electricity services in the event of power outages and reduce the need for grids to use traditional energy sources.
In order to encourage the use of EVs by customers, utilities can offer incentives to install EV chargers on their premises. These incentives can be in the form of vouchers, rebates or cashbacks. Utility companies can also implement time-of-use rates to encourage owners of electric vehicles to shift their load from peak demand times. These measures can help to reduce the load on the electricity grid and reduce CO2 emissions.
In order to integrate EVs with the grid, it is important to develop charging infrastructure that will enable communication between EVs and the power system. This includes the installation smart charging stations and EV to grid interfaces (G2V), which allow information to be transferred between the EVs and the charging station. These technologies can improve EV charge speeds, monitor EV State of Charge (SOC), give real-time feedback to the driver.
A secure and safe EV charger network is also crucial to maintain the confidence of the user in this technology. These networks are complicated, and must be designed in a way that protects against cybersecurity threats like hacking malware, phishing and hacking. These threats can impact the safety and performance of EVs as well as the grid in general.
